England, 1908: tender romance and glittering society in a sparkling "golden age"

AN EDWARDIAN ADVENTURE

A passion for presenting historical pageants seemed to sweep King Edward VII's England in 1908, and the little town of Gressington was caught up in it. But Ambrose Hockliffe, the famous actor-playwright brought in by Lady Rodmayne to supervise, found himself playing a part in a romantic drama that outshone the pageant itself--when his interest in Lady Rodmayne's daughter Millicent and the roving eye of Millicent's dashing fiance set the stage for an explosive scene.

A warm re-creation of a "golden age" of leisure and liveliness as well as a sparkling tale of romance, The Year of the Pageant is a deliciously diverting novel.
